Output 11811e3ec43391a8756b8b7e57566075b98bb6ff468c18cd4d9ce861f76de8ca:1

value
10538343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e9c2bf1bf6998bb6f3ede5fe4ee908bba181f5 OP_EQUAL
address
3CFufarEDW8NT6rw62uoi9NgnUUqRXAttw
transaction
11811e3ec43391a8756b8b7e57566075b98bb6ff468c18cd4d9ce861f76de8ca
spent
true